Iliac Kinking Clinical Trial
— SALTY-TURTLEOfficial title:
Application de l'oxymétrie Dynamique et Des Index de Pression Pour le Diagnostic Des Plicatures Iliaques du Sportif

Aim of the study is to test the feasibility of transcutaneous oxygen pressure (TcPO2) recording in the diagnosis of iliac kinking in 20 patients with suspected of endofibrosisoriliackinking and 40 asymptomatic control heathy subjects
